[conky] Compile error

Pagina: 1
Acties:

  • icyx
  • Registratie: Januari 2007
  • Niet online

icyx

chown -R us ./base

Topicstarter
Hallo allemaal
Aangezien ik een eee-pc heb gekocht, wilde ik natuurlijk fluxbox met o.a. conky aanslingeren. Conky wil ik echter zelf compilen omdat conky 1.4.9 wat extra interessante opties heeft vergelijken met de debian etch versie. Al met al dus de source naarbinnengehaald, alle dependencies geinstalleerd, en een ./configure gedraaid met de volgende opties:
code:
1
./configure --disable-own-window --enable-audacious=no --disable-mpd --enable-rss=no --enable-wlan

Dit gaat perfect, ik zie ook geen enkele fout. Er komt dan ook het volgende in beeld: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
conky 1.4.9 configured successfully:

 Installing into:   /usr/local
 System config dir: ${prefix}/etc
 C compiler flags:         -I/usr/include/freetype2   -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include   -Wall -W
 Linker flags:       -Wl,-O1
 Libraries:          -liw  -lX11   -lXext   -lXdamage -lXfixes   -lXft -lfontconfig   -lglib-2.0

 * x11:
  x11 support:      yes
  xdamage support:  yes
  xdbe support:     yes
  xft support:      yes

 * music detection:
  audacious:        no
  bmpx:             no
  mpd:              no
  xmms2:            no

 * general:
  hddtemp:          yes
  portmon:          yes
  rss:              no
  wireless:         yes

Ga ik echter compilen, zie ik na make het volgende:
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
Making all in src
make[1]: Entering directory `/home/user/.cvs/conky-1.4.9/src'
make  all-am
make[2]: Entering directory `/home/user/.cvs/conky-1.4.9/src'
gcc -DHAVE_CONFIG_H -I. -DSYSTEM_CONFIG_FILE=\"/usr/local/etc/conky/conky.conf\"    -I/usr/include/freetype2   -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include   -Wall -W -MT common.o -MD -MP -MF .deps/common.Tpo -c -o common.o common.c
mv -f .deps/common.Tpo .deps/common.Po
gcc -DHAVE_CONFIG_H -I. -DSYSTEM_CONFIG_FILE=\"/usr/local/etc/conky/conky.conf\"    -I/usr/include/freetype2   -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include   -Wall -W -MT conky.o -MD -MP -MF .deps/conky.Tpo -c -o conky.o conky.c
conky.c: In function ‘main’:
conky.c:7883: error: ‘own_window’ undeclared (first use in this function)
conky.c:7883: error: (Each undeclared identifier is reported only once
conky.c:7883: error: for each function it appears in.)
conky.c:7886: error: ‘background_colour’ undeclared (first use in this function)
make[2]: *** [conky.o] Error 1
make[2]: Leaving directory `/home/user/.cvs/conky-1.4.9/src'
make[1]: *** [all] Error 2
make[1]: Leaving directory `/home/user/.cvs/conky-1.4.9/src'
make: *** [all-recursive] Error 1

De compile loopt dus stuck, en ik kan niet wijs worden waarom. Wat ik echter zo raar vind is dat hij o.a. loopt te klagen over own_window, terwijl ik die met ./configure wel degelijk uitgeschakeld heb, ik heb het namelijkh elemaal niet nodig. Heeft iemand een idee wat het probleem is? Voor zover ik kan zien ben ik ook echt de enige met dit probleem...

[ Voor 0% gewijzigd door icyx op 24-12-2007 13:15 . Reden: foutje in copy-paste... ]

When you think you’ve succeeded / but something’s missing / means you have been defeated / by greed, your weakness.


  • schnitzelcore
  • Registratie: December 2003
  • Laatst online: 13-08-2021
Waarom compilen? Waarom haal je Conky niet gewoon uit Sid?

Windows is exiting. Is this OK?


  • icyx
  • Registratie: Januari 2007
  • Niet online

icyx

chown -R us ./base

Topicstarter
grondige dependencies, dikke libc6 updates, die de standaard asus-software 'breaken'. Deze software wil ik er wel oplaten eigenlijk, dus vandaar.

When you think you’ve succeeded / but something’s missing / means you have been defeated / by greed, your weakness.


  • icyx
  • Registratie: Januari 2007
  • Niet online

icyx

chown -R us ./base

Topicstarter
Niemand een idee? Ik wil wel conky eigenlijk wel onder de kerstboom vinden :+

When you think you’ve succeeded / but something’s missing / means you have been defeated / by greed, your weakness.


  • mithras
  • Registratie: Maart 2003
  • Niet online
offtopic:
Twee keer --disable-own-window :?

  • icyx
  • Registratie: Januari 2007
  • Niet online

icyx

chown -R us ./base

Topicstarter
mithras schreef op maandag 24 december 2007 @ 12:13:
offtopic:
Twee keer --disable-own-window :?
offtopic:
Dat heb je als je niet op zit te letten met copy-pasten. Ik heb het nog op gezocht, ik heb inderdaad waarschijnlijk iets fout gedaan, ik zie hem 'hier' niet met dubbele --disable-own-window. Bedankt voor je oplettendheid in ieder geval

When you think you’ve succeeded / but something’s missing / means you have been defeated / by greed, your weakness.


  • bobo1on1
  • Registratie: Juli 2001
  • Laatst online: 19-10-2025
Mja ze zijn een #ifdef OWN_WINDOW en een #endif vergeten, als je de --disable-own-window optie van configure weglaat compiled hij prima.

Impedance, a measure of opposition to time-varying electric current in an electric circuit.
Not to be confused with impotence.


  • icyx
  • Registratie: Januari 2007
  • Niet online

icyx

chown -R us ./base

Topicstarter
bobo1on1 schreef op maandag 24 december 2007 @ 22:54:
Mja ze zijn een #ifdef OWN_WINDOW en een #endif vergeten, als je de --disable-own-window optie van configure weglaat compiled hij prima.
_/-\o_
Zo simpel, en het werkt, heel erg bedankt!

When you think you’ve succeeded / but something’s missing / means you have been defeated / by greed, your weakness.

Pagina: 1